Titan America is Hiring a HR Coordinator Near Orlando, FL

Job ID: 4127
Location:Orlando, Florida, United States
Function: Human Resources
Full/Part Time: Full Time

This salary non- exempt position will report directly to the Sr. Human Resources Manager. This position provides professional HR support and consultation to managers and employees within the Florida business. This position is also responsible for various administrative HR duties and Payroll processing for the plant in addition to performing some recruitment and filing duties as outlined below. The ideal candidate possesses a diverse HR generalist background with a proven track record of continuous improvement.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Assist with Open Enrollment and benefits questions. Assists employees in insurance matters.
  • Process changes in employee information such as direct deposits, address, and W4 exemptions.
  • Prepares Personnel Action Forms (PAFs) when required.
  • Prepare new hire packages and conduct New Employee Orientation.
  • File and maintain hourly personnel files.
  • Follow all company safety regulations.
  • Provide HR support in the areas of employee development, recruitment, compensation/benefits, organizational development, performance management and employee and labor relations.
  • Assist with execution of the recruitment process to include:
    • Development of recruitment plans, sourcing strategies, and resources.
    • Mutually creating service level agreement with hiring managers to ensure expectations are established and achieved.
    • Job posting, phone screening, interviewing, communication with candidates and managers.
    • Managing the requisition log and applicant/interview/hire reports via online database.
  • Assist with performance management efforts to include reward and recognition, conflict resolution and corrective action.
  • Outline employee development to include planning, coordination, design, and facilitation of training programs for employees of all levels.
  • Support deployment of HR programs, including performance management, salary administration and implementation, staffing, headcount planning/reporting, retention and career development.
  • Ensure compliance and conformance regulation along with diversity initiatives within the organization and geographic locations.
  • Establish and maintain relationships with Colleges and Universities and plan partnership activities.
  • Stay abreast of changing laws, requirements and practices in the HR field.
  • Assist with coordination of different employee events.
  • Collect training for region and update in Success Factors.
  • Assist with invoice approvals for recruiting agencies.
  • Utilize handshake, LinkedIn, and SuccessFactors to recruit Interns.
  • Conduct exit interviews and prepare final termination paperwork for departing staff members.
  • Complete other special projects as needed.

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business, Organizational Development, Human Resources or related field.
  • Minimum 1 year of HR/Recruiting experience.
  • Must have an understanding of fundamental HR concepts, employment laws, contemporary HR practices and issues.
  • Bilingual, English & Spanish.
  • Self-starter, results-oriented with a proven record of instituting continuous improvement.
  • Flexible and able to adapt to quickly changing work environment.
  • Ability to manage multiple issues and projects concurrently.
  • Effective oral and written communication skills. Must be able to communicate effectively at all levels within the organization.
  • Excellent interpersonal/influencing skills, with ability to effectively coach frontline leaders, build relationships and leverage resources.
  • Strong problem solving, facilitation and analytical skills.
  • End user expertise with MS Office (i.e. MS Word, MS Excel, MS PowerPoint)
